To the uninitiated eye, a man’s suit is a simple thing—cloth, thread, and buttons. But to the patternmaker, it is a feat of engineering. Unlike womenswear, where the pattern often seeks to mold and reveal the body, the art of patternmaking for menswear is historically an exercise in architecture. It is about building a silhouette that commands space, creating a structure that allows the fabric to drape over the body like a second skin, hiding flaws and exaggerating the ideal.
| | Author | Focus & Key Strengths |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Patternmaking for Menswear | Gareth Kershaw | Contemporary & Casual: Geared more towards modern styles, streetwear, and casual designs. Features 20 complete, ready-to-use patterns . | | Fashion Patternmaking for Menswear | Antonio Donnanno | Professional Reference: A complete guide for industry professionals, teachers, and advanced students. Covers a huge range of garment types, from shirts and trousers to underwear and knitwear. |
